Output d712c26dda689c122bcbf5c57b214897eb6152499755a3fc3a1318189a594e7c:68

value
42432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1eab28e2a9219489ceeb6a828319f48a8ce2eda OP_EQUAL
address
3HukgZhkYuMqQaB4E4FWMVtJLSqBBTLxJM
transaction
d712c26dda689c122bcbf5c57b214897eb6152499755a3fc3a1318189a594e7c
spent
true